No tools. (Well, unless you count SQL*DBA and stuff like that.) Actually, the v7 in use today may still be Alpha (it was installed at 12 customer sites I believe); beta either just shipped or is just about to ship, so I doubt many sites have it up yet.

BTW, Alpha v7 has been in use for some time inside Oracle; we use it for one of our production databases. The Bug database. (Fitting, I think. As for the tools, that has nothing to do with the release of RDBMS v7.

The next set of tools is supposed to be v4 Forms, v2 ReportWriter, v2 of Oracle Graphics, v2 Oracle Mail, and so on like that. But since v4 Forms is supposed to work with v6 RDBMS, and v3 Forms should work with v7, basically everything is supposed to work with everything else, so you won't need new tools. (Then again, I'm not in the Tools Group, so I could be entirely wrong -- this is what I remember being told.)

Also, I have no idea what the release schedule will end up being for the new tools. But they will have their own beta program, separate from the v7 RDBMS beta program. (Will have, or already do have, I dunno how far along they are.)

Incidentally, SQL*Net v2 was announced a while ago. So I want to mention that Net v2 will work with RDBMS versions 6 and 7, and that Net v1 will also work with RDBMS versions 6 and 7. Or so I was told by the marketing folks.
